Costs

Costs are a major concern for many patients seeking treatment for psychiatric issues and it's normal to be concerned about costs. You should not let your fear of cost keep you from getting the treatment you need. There are a variety of ways to cut down on the cost of your psychiatrist visits, including insurance and sliding scale rates. These options can help you save some money and find the right psychiatrist for your needs.

Psychiatrists are specialists in mental health and can provide you with a diagnosis, an intervention and treatment plans. They may prescribe medication to treat your condition. Psychiatrists are medical doctors, and they have one of two degrees: MD (doctor of medicine) or DO (doctor of osteopathy). Before they can be licensed to practice, they must have completed medical school and an psychiatry residency program. They can practice in private psychotherapist practices and hospitals, and treat patients of all ages.

Check out the fees of any psychiatrists in your area prior to you schedule an appointment. Some psychiatrists will charge a flat rate per session, while others have a sliding scale based on your income. You can also find a doctor who accepts insurance by visiting the website of your health insurance company.

Therapists can also be found at a reduced cost or for free in your community through community clinics or hospitals. These therapists are typically interns or students in training who provide therapy for reduced rates or for free as part of their experience hours towards licensure. Some of these providers provide the option of telepsychiatry, which is becoming more popular and is less expensive than in-person sessions.

Many people suffering from mental illness don't have sufficient health insurance or have no coverage at all. The good news is that the Affordable Care Act requires insurers to cover mental health services at the same rate as physical health benefits. In addition, some community mental health clinics and mental hospitals will have sliding scale rates. You can find these facilities by searching SAMHSA's mental treatment services locator.

Online services such as BetterHelp and Talkspace provide low-cost psychiatric assessment private treatments. These services let you receive the assistance you require without leaving your home or compromise your privacy. They're also typically more affordable than traditional in-person therapy and many insurance companies will cover them.

Insurance

There are ways to lower the cost. You can determine if your insurance covers the visit, for instance. You can also look online for a doctor who is accepted by your insurance and is close to your home. There are also telehealth clinics, which provide low-cost or no-cost consultations. Your GP may be able recommend a psychiatric hospital in your region.

Psychiatrists treat mental illnesses like depression and anxiety disorders. They have advanced training in biological, psychosocial, and other approaches to mental health. They have a medical degree with a focus on mental health.

The majority of health insurance policies provide the treatment of psychiatric disorders. However, the nature of coverage differs from plan to plan. Certain plans provide a separate benefit for mental health, while others only include counseling and inpatient services. The Affordable Care Act requires all health insurance companies to cover mental health care and a majority of insurers provide a wider range of benefits than they did previously.

In addition to making sure that your treatment for psychiatric disorders is covered, you must consider the fees of different doctors. Certain psychiatrists charge more than others. This could be due to factors like the location, years of experience, and specialization expertise. It is also important to find an experienced doctor who is comfortable working on your specific needs.

If you don't have insurance it is important to find a psychiatrist that can work within your budget. You can begin by examining your local listings, then expanding the search to find a psychiatrist who offers an affordable sliding scale. If you're unable to afford a private psychiatrist, consider using a community mental health center instead.

You may also ask your employer if they have an employee assistance program that can assist you in paying for the treatment of psychiatric disorders. These programs are typically accessible to employees who are eligible for at least 20 hours of sick time per year. The cost of psychiatric treatment is often higher than other medical procedures, but it's still a worthwhile investment in your mental health.

Sliding scale

A sliding scale is a model of pricing that mental health professionals employ to assist clients with low incomes pay for their services. It is similar to other industries' fee-based on income structures, including primary health clinics and law firms. The sliding scale of a therapist is typically determined by the client's monthly income and is determined by their ability to pay. Although many therapists don't offer this option, it is worth asking if they do. You may be surprised to find that many of them do offer the sliding scale.

The sliding scales can be a great option for people who otherwise cannot afford therapy. Online services

Online psychotherapy services offer patients simple, affordable access to accredited and licensed psychiatrists. Telehealth sessions are also available, which are usually cheaper than traditional appointments. These services are particularly helpful for those living in rural areas or underserved regions, where it may be difficult to find psychiatrists. They also offer an option for those without insurance or with a low income. private psychiatrist cambridge health insurance typically permits you to use the service for free or at a reduced rate. Many companies also offer employee assistance programs to help pay the cost of psychiatric treatments.

Psychiatrists specialize in mental illnesses and utilize biological and psychosocial methods to treat patients. They are able to diagnose and treat many different disorders, including anxiety, depression and bipolar disorder. They can also prescribe medication, which is often used to manage mental symptoms. They can also schedule regular appointments to confirm that the medication is working.

The top online psychiatry companies offer a variety of features including secure telehealth technology and videoconferencing. They also have a complete collection of resources to aid patients in navigating their issues, including self-help guides, videos and FAQs. Some online psychiatry services offer support groups, so patients can talk about their concerns with other members.

Most online psychiatry services work with the majority of insurance plans, however it is important to confirm with your insurance prior to making an appointment. Some telehealth platforms only accept providers in-network and can result in higher upfront copays and charges. Some platforms may also not accept insurance, requiring you to pay outside of network and submit the claim on your own.

Online psychiatry is most popular through Talkiatry and Doctor on Demand. Users report high satisfaction with these services, and a majority say that their prescribers were professional and genuinely caring. The users also gave their psychiatrists high marks for their bedside manner and thought that they took the time to evaluate their skills. Some online psychiatry services require a monthly membership, while others offer a pay per appointment option that can be charged to a credit card or PayPal account, or a health savings or flexible spending account (FSA).
